How much do creative strategist j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for creative strategist in Ohio is $88,300.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$65,100.00 and $97,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does a creative strategist typically collaborate with other departments during campaign development?

Creative Strategists regularly work alongside marketing, design, and analytics teams to ensure campaign concepts are both innovative and aligned with broader business goals. This collaboration often involves brainstorming sessions, feedback loops, and aligning messaging across platforms. By integrating insights from different departments, Creative Strategists help create cohesive campaigns that resonate with target audiences and drive measurable results. Open communication and adaptability are key to managing cross-functional expectations and timelines.

What degree do you need to be a creative strategist?

A creative strategist typically holds a bachelor's degree in fields such as marketing, advertising, communications, or related areas. While a specific degree is not always required, relevant education combined with experience in branding, digital media, or creative development is valuable for the role.

How much do entry level creative strategists make?

Entry-level creative strategists typically earn between $45,000 and $65,000 annually, depending on location, industry, and company size. Starting salaries may also include benefits such as health insurance and opportunities for skill development in areas like market research and campaign planning.

What is a creative strategist?

A Creative Strategist is a professional who develops innovative ideas and strategies to help brands effectively communicate with their target audiences. They blend creativity with data-driven insights to craft compelling marketing campaigns and content across various media platforms. Creative Strategists often work closely with designers, copywriters, and marketing teams to ensure that creative solutions align with business goals and brand identity. Their role involves understanding market trends, consumer behavior, and the latest digital tools to deliver impactful and engaging campaigns.

What is a creative strategist?

Creative strategists develop media strategies, often in marketing departments or for advertising agencies. Job duties include updating ad campaigns based on trends in the industry. They also perform market research and lead focus groups to help narrow the focus of a campaign. They work closely with members of other departments and direct people below them in the marketing or copywriting departments.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a creative strategist?

To thrive as a Creative Strategist, you need a solid background in marketing, brand development, and creative concepting, often supported by a degree in advertising, communications, or a related field. Familiarity with digital marketing platforms, data analytics tools, and creative software such as Adobe Creative Suite is typically required. Exceptional communication, critical thinking, and collaboration skills help you effectively convey ideas and work cross-functionally. These abilities are crucial for developing impactful campaigns that align with client goals and drive business results.

What does a creative strategist do?

A creative strategist develops and guides innovative marketing and branding campaigns by analyzing target audiences, market trends, and brand goals. They collaborate with creative teams, use data-driven insights, and often utilize tools like Adobe Creative Suite or analytics platforms to craft effective strategies that align with business objectives.
